Shanghai, China

No dates selected

Sort by

Price per night in

Property type
Distance from the city center
Facilities and services
At the hotel
In the room
Accommodation features
Star rating
Rating by reviews
Districts
Hotel name
Places of interest
Nearest subway station
Hotel chain

Hotels in Shanghai

: 11825 options found

Select dates so you can see the availability and exact prices.

No.4671 Caoangong Road Jiading District, Shanghai
24.4 km from the center of Shanghai

Room in this hotel

from RSD 4,534
per night
No.51 Daxin Street, Zhujiajiao Town, Qingpu District, 201713, Shanghai, China, Shanghai
41.8 km from the center of Shanghai

Room in this hotel

from RSD 7,697
per night
Building 1, No.328 Lanxue Road, Pudong District, Shanghai, China, Shanghai
20.1 km from the center of Shanghai
4.7 km from the Zhangjiang Road subway station

Room in this hotel

from RSD 7,278
per night
102, No. 11, Building 3, Lane 728, Shanghai
21.1 km from the center of Shanghai

Room in this hotel

from RSD 41,721
per night
No.20, Zhoujiazhai, East Xinchun Cun, Shanghai
22.7 km from the center of Shanghai

Room in this hotel

from RSD 5,722
per night
456 Yaodun Village, Waxie Town, Zhoupu, Pudong District, 200122 Shanghai, Shanghai
21.5 km from the center of Shanghai

Room in this hotel

from RSD 7,278
per night
No. 4518, Chuansha Road, Pudong District, Pudong, Shanghai, China, Shanghai
21.8 km from the center of Shanghai

Room in this hotel

from RSD 14,316
per night
No.88, Feijiazhai, Jielong Village, Shanghai
21.6 km from the center of Shanghai

Room in this hotel

from RSD 4,830
per night
No.71, 328 Lanxue Road, Pudong District, Shanghai
20.5 km from the center of Shanghai
5 km from the Zhangjiang Road subway station

Room in this hotel

from RSD 11,349
per night
No.800 Miaochuan Road, Chuansha Pudong District, Shanghai
22.5 km from the center of Shanghai

Room in this hotel

from RSD 7,278
per night
No.88 Beichenghao Road, Chuansha, Shanghai
22.4 km from the center of Shanghai

Room in this hotel

from RSD 15,124
per night
738 Fanghuang Village, Chongming Island, Santiaogang, Shanghai, Shanghai
41.1 km from the center of Shanghai

Room in this hotel

from RSD 7,278
per night
123 Shenmei Road, Shanghai
18.6 km from the center of Shanghai

Room in this hotel

from RSD 7,278
per night
No.2359 Yin Du Road, Minhang, China, Shanghai
15.8 km from the center of Shanghai
3.5 km from the Xinzhuang subway station

Room in this hotel

from RSD 6,595
per night
Floor 1, No. 12, Lane 1218, Fuxing Middle Road, Xuhui District, Xuhui, 200085 Shanghai, China, Shanghai
2.3 km from the center of Shanghai
3.5 km from the Nanpu Bridge subway station

Room in this hotel

from RSD 4,296
per night
No. 1 Lane 115 Si Nan Road, Shanghai
2.2 km from the center of Shanghai
2.6 km from the Nanpu Bridge subway station

Room in this hotel

from RSD 11,235
per night
No 3 Lane 1200 (M) Huai Hai Road, Shanghai, China, Shanghai
2.4 km from the center of Shanghai
4.1 km from the Nanpu Bridge subway station

Room in this hotel

from RSD 11,235
per night
No. 3 Lane 1262 (M) Fu Xing Road, 200000, Shanghai, China, Shanghai
2.4 km from the center of Shanghai
3.7 km from the Nanpu Bridge subway station

Room in this hotel

from RSD 11,235
per night
No. 11 Lane 125 An Tai Road, Shanghai
4.5 km from the center of Shanghai

Room in this hotel

from RSD 11,235
per night
No 6 Lane 159 (S) Mao Ming Road, Shanghai
1.9 km from the center of Shanghai
3.3 km from the Nanpu Bridge subway station

Room in this hotel

from RSD 11,235
per night